The reason for NOT buying a Combi 747, as given by management at a previous company, is that you cannot get a combi certified by the FAA unless the Cargo is FORWARD of the passenger cabin. Foreign carriers apparently have no such restriction when dealing with their respective government agencies.

We were told that studies deemed this limitation to be unacceptable to passengers, even though it's supposedly safer, and that it caused some problems with flight crew/cabin crew interaction.

There was a rumor that we were going to lease some Euro certified combi's(747-300), but that never panned out.
